Slitting machine is an important equipment in modern industrial production, which can achieve efficient production and precise cutting. So, how does a slitter machine achieve efficient production and precise cutting?
The slitting machine adopts advanced technology and cutting methods, which can achieve a high-speed and high-precision cutting process. Equipped with advanced automation systems and electronic controls, cutting operations can be completed quickly and accurately. The machine can automatically adjust the cutting speed, cutting angle and cutting position according to the preset parameters, ensuring that every cut is accurate and consistent. This high degree of automation makes slitters very popular in mass production and industrial applications that require high-quality cuts.
In addition, the slitter also achieves precise cutting by employing advanced sensor technology and a real-time feedback system. It senses and monitors the position, size, and shape of the material, and then adjusts the movement of the cutting tool based on this information, ensuring a high degree of accuracy and consistency with every cut. Whether it is for film materials or paper, cloth and other materials, the slitting machine can achieve precision cutting to meet the needs of different industries.
The slitter's efficient production and precise cutting also benefit from its quick tool change and easy operation. It is equipped with a quick tool change system, which can quickly change different types and specifications of cutting tools, reducing downtime in production. In addition, the operation interface of the slitter is usually simple and intuitive, and the operator only needs to complete the entire cutting process with simple instructions and settings, further improving production efficiency.
To sum up, the slitting machine achieves efficient production and precise cutting through advanced technology and system optimization design. It uses an automated system and electronic control for fast and accurate cutting operations, sensor technology and real-time feedback systems for highly accurate cutting, as well as quick tool changes and easy operation. These characteristics make the slitter an indispensable piece of equipment in today's industrial production, providing high-quality and efficient production solutions for various industries.
